/** * @license * Copyright 2025 Google LLC * SPDX-License-Identifier: Apache-2.0 */ import { Content } from '@google/genai'; import { DEFAULT_GEMINI_FLASH_MODEL } from '../config/models.js'; import { GeminiClient } from '../core/client.js'; import { GeminiChat } from '../core/geminiChat.js'; import { isFunctionResponse } from './messageInspectors.js'; const CHECK_PROMPT = `Analyze *only* the content and structure of your immediately preceding response (your last turn in the conversation history). Based *strictly* on that response, determine who should logically speak next: the 'user' or the 'model' (you). **Decision Rules (apply in order):** 1. **Model Continues:** If your last response explicitly states an immediate next action *you* intend to take (e.g., "Next, I will...", "Now I'll process...", "Moving on to analyze...", indicates an intended tool call that didn't execute), OR if the response seems clearly incomplete (cut off mid-thought without a natural conclusion), then the **'model'** should speak next. 2. **Question to User:** If your last response ends with a direct question specifically addressed *to the user*, then the **'user'** should speak next. 3. **Waiting for User:** If your last response completed a thought, statement, or task *and* does not meet the criteria for Rule 1 (Model Continues) or Rule 2 (Question to User), it implies a pause expecting user input or reaction. In this case, the **'user'** should speak next.`; const RESPONSE_SCHEMA: Record = { type: 'object', properties: { reasoning: { type: 'string', description: "Brief explanation justifying the 'next_speaker' choice based *strictly* on the applicable rule and the content/structure of the preceding turn.", }, next_speaker: { type: 'string', enum: ['user', 'model'], description: 'Who should speak next based *only* on the preceding turn and the decision rules', }, }, required: ['reasoning', 'next_speaker'], }; export interface NextSpeakerResponse { reasoning: string; next_speaker: 'user' | 'model'; } export async function checkNextSpeaker( chat: GeminiChat, geminiClient: GeminiClient, abortSignal: AbortSignal, ): Promise { // We need to capture the curated history because there are many moments when the model will return invalid turns // that when passed back up to the endpoint will break subsequent calls. An example of this is when the model decides // to respond with an empty part collection if you were to send that message back to the server it will respond with // a 400 indicating that model part collections MUST have content. const curatedHistory = chat.getHistory(/* curated */ true); // Ensure there's a model response to analyze if (curatedHistory.length === 0) { // Cannot determine next speaker if history is empty. return null; } const comprehensiveHistory = chat.getHistory(); // If comprehensiveHistory is empty, there is no last message to check. // This case should ideally be caught by the curatedHistory.length check earlier, // but as a safeguard: if (comprehensiveHistory.length === 0) { return null; } const lastComprehensiveMessage = comprehensiveHistory[comprehensiveHistory.length - 1]; // If the last message is a user message containing only function_responses, // then the model should speak next. if ( lastComprehensiveMessage && isFunctionResponse(lastComprehensiveMessage) ) { return { reasoning: 'The last message was a function response, so the model should speak next.', next_speaker: 'model', }; } if ( lastComprehensiveMessage && lastComprehensiveMessage.role === 'model' && lastComprehensiveMessage.parts && lastComprehensiveMessage.parts.length === 0 ) { lastComprehensiveMessage.parts.push({ text: '' }); return { reasoning: 'The last message was a filler model message with no content (nothing for user to act on), model should speak next.', next_speaker: 'model', }; } // Things checked out. Let's proceed to potentially making an LLM request. const lastMessage = curatedHistory[curatedHistory.length - 1]; if (!lastMessage || lastMessage.role !== 'model') { // Cannot determine next speaker if the last turn wasn't from the model // or if history is empty. return null; } const contents: Content[] = [ ...curatedHistory, { role: 'user', parts: [{ text: CHECK_PROMPT }] }, ]; try { const parsedResponse = (await geminiClient.generateJson( contents, RESPONSE_SCHEMA, abortSignal, DEFAULT_GEMINI_FLASH_MODEL, )) as unknown as NextSpeakerResponse; if ( parsedResponse && parsedResponse.next_speaker && ['user', 'model'].includes(parsedResponse.next_speaker) ) { return parsedResponse; } return null; } catch (error) { console.warn( 'Failed to talk to Gemini endpoint when seeing if conversation should continue.', error, ); return null; } }
